温馨提示×

centos下sqladmin日志查看方法

小樊
48
2025-09-22 08:11:37
栏目: 云计算

在CentOS系统下,要查看SQLAdmin(通常指的是用于管理SQL Server的命令行工具sqlcmd)的日志,可以采取以下几种方法:

方法一:使用sqlcmd的内置日志功能

  1. 启用日志记录
  • 在启动sqlcmd时,可以使用-L选项来启用日志记录。
  • 例如:sqlcmd -L -S server_name -U username -P password -d database_name
  1. 查看日志文件
  • 日志文件通常会被保存在当前工作目录下,文件名可能类似于sqlcmd.log
  • 使用文本编辑器(如vinano)打开日志文件查看内容。

方法二:检查系统日志

如果sqlcmd没有直接生成日志文件,或者你想查看更广泛的系统级信息,可以检查CentOS的系统日志。

  1. 使用journalctl命令
  • journalctl是systemd的日志管理工具,可以查看各种服务的日志。
  • 要查看sqlcmd相关的日志,可以使用以下命令:
    journalctl -u sqlcmd.service 
    注意:如果sqlcmd不是作为systemd服务运行的,这个命令可能不会返回结果。
  1. 查看/var/log/messages/var/log/syslog
  • 这些文件通常包含系统级的日志信息,包括启动和停止服务的记录。
  • 使用文本编辑器打开这些文件,并搜索与sqlcmd相关的条目。

方法三:检查SQL Server日志

如果sqlcmd是与SQL Server一起使用的,那么SQL Server本身也可能有自己的日志系统。

  1. 使用SQL Server Management Studio (SSMS)
  • 如果你有访问SSMS的权限,可以通过它来查看SQL Server的错误日志和常规查询日志。
  1. 使用T-SQL命令
  • 连接到SQL Server后,可以运行以下T-SQL命令来查看日志:
    EXEC xp_readerrorlog; 
    这将显示SQL Server的错误日志。

注意事项

  • 确保你有足够的权限来访问和查看这些日志文件。
  • 日志文件可能会变得非常大,定期清理旧日志是一个好习惯。
  • 如果你不确定如何操作,建议咨询系统管理员或参考相关文档。

总之,查看SQLAdmin日志的方法取决于你的具体环境和配置。通过上述方法之一,你应该能够找到并查看所需的日志信息。

0